Rail 2/3/4G/WiFi Antenna with GPS
The TRNBG antenna series is designed specifically for use on trains, underground or overground. With an omnidirectional peak gain of over 5dBi the TRNBG-7-27 series covers all bands from 698-960MHz and 1710-6000MHz, with the option of a surge protectedGPS antenna, all in one housing.
Housed in a UV stabilised, flame retardant Lexan housing, the TRNBG series is fully weatherproof ensuring that the antenna´s performance is never compromised even when subjected to industrial carriage wash systems.
The TRNB antennas have also been designed to meet various European industry standards.
Applications
The rugged design of the Panorama Low Profile range makes the antennas suitable for trains, heavy goods vehicles, buses and other applications that require a heavy duty unit. The Panorama TRNB antenna meets the following industry standards: EN50144 (vibrations standard) EN50155 (electrical isolation standard).
Trains
The TRNBG series is designed for trains and has been tested to demanding, high-level industry standards.
Buses
The high impact capable housing is also ideal for buses, as it can withstand the extreme impacts that occasionally occur in road-based mass transit networks as well as the unusual levels of wear and tear that components operating within such systems are subjected to.
Light Rail
The TRNBG antenna is suitable for almost any heavy-duty transit application, covering Cellular/LTE/GSM-R & GPS
